Output e36b2d20ce5da35cabfb86aaf830cbd13e6a8f194f0f7571a69d4e488ff88fa4:4

value
68137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592bb0b17b2bd47d50455d0afa218a74607cfffb OP_EQUAL
address
39pWQGMY2z6hTYQ8jyxB71hQAPENpgRT2e
transaction
e36b2d20ce5da35cabfb86aaf830cbd13e6a8f194f0f7571a69d4e488ff88fa4
confirmations
264935
spent
true